List of products by brand Helion

Helion is a Polish publishing house established in 1991 and based in Gliwice, Silesia. The range of Helion's publishing offer comprises over 3.000 titles, which are mainly books on computer science and computer programming. The share of Helion in the Polish market for IT literature is over 80%, which makes the company one of the leaders in the field of technical literature in Poland. Oficyna Wydawnicza Helion cares for the up-to-dateness of the content of its books and constantly introduces updated editions - it is related to the progress observed also in the field of IT. Helion has won many awards and honors. Helion's publishing offer is especially popular among professional programmers, students and pupils of schools and technical universities, as well as academic teachers.

Literature for programmers writing in JavaScript

The book titled. "JavaScript in practice. Create a twitter bot" by Lynn Beighley is an excellent compendium of practical and theoretical knowledge about JavaScript and Node.js software. In the book you will find extensively described practical code examples of programs written in the Node.js environment using JavaScript. The content of the book was created in such a way that it can be easily understood by both beginners and advanced users. In this book you will learn how to write a twitter bot controlled by the iconic Raspberry Pi single board minicomputer.

Literature for embedded systems enthusiasts

Another item from Helion offered by the Botland store is "Raspberry Pi Zero W. Controllers, Sensors, Controllers and Gadgets" by Akkana Peck. The content of the book presents the construction, characteristics and examples of practical use of the Raspberry Pi Zero W - the smallest of the mass-produced minicomputers in the Raspberry Pi series. You will learn how to write simple programs using buttons and LEDs, how to use the Pi Zero W to control external devices using Wi-Fi and Bluetooth, as well as which GPIO pins are responsible for which functionalities, which enable the implementation of more advanced projects such as controlling electrical drives and reading data from measurement sensors.
